## Search Relevance Tuning

Relevance weights for Quillbrook search live in `ranker_config.yaml`. Do not edit boost values by hand; use the tuning harness so changes get logged. Title-match boost is capped at 4.0 after the Q3 regression. Synonym expansion runs before stemming — order matters, don't swap. Rebuild the eval set quarterly; stale judgments caused the February drift. Any change over 0.5 on a weight needs a side-by-side eval run. Full tuning history and rationale are on the internal page here.

runbook for tagef-tagef: https://confluence.qorvelcorp.internal/display/browse/view/67670d0e2976

Quick note for sync: the Larkspur flag framework's CI gate keeps failing on the canary-percentage lint, even when configs are fine. Turns out the linter caches stale schema from last sprint. Workaround: clear the schema cache step before lint. Dena has a proper fix in review. If you hit it, reference the failing build token below.

pipeline stamp: htk9_ce63042d9

Meeting notes — payroll admin, Thursday. The crew at the Norrfell quarry site still has no working printer, so payslips will go out on paper from head office again this cycle. Jessa will print and seal the envelopes by Wednesday; each is named and the batch will be banded together. Delivery is by courier as before, and the hand-over instruction follows below.

courier memo of yawep-yafog: the pramir ulaix courier leaves the ulavan aldix frair zorok oliiel joreth rusdor fenvan ledger at gate 1305 under passcode 514738

## Authentication

Heads up: the nightly reindex job (`reindex_nightly.py`) talks to the Lanternfish search cluster, and that cluster won't accept anonymous writes anymore — we locked it down last sprint. The job now authenticates as the `reindex-runner` service identity against Corvid Gateway, and the token is injected via the `LF_INDEX_TOKEN` env var in the scheduler config. Nothing clever going on, just a bearer header on every batch request. For review purposes, the staging credential currently in use is listed below.

service key, kadug-kadup: kto15_rN23XLAYImmZgrJ